Invisible Fencing For A Dog Could Be The Solution1
Most all invisible fencing for dogs usually contain special professional equipment that will let the dog, or other pet know they have gone too far. Well, that all sound pretty good and quick and easy, but the reality is that all this will require some training in order to get your dog to understand. It works this way, folks. The fencing is put underground and your dog wears a special collar. Then, as your dog gets close to the fence, the collar will send out a "beep" which, in turn signals your dog to turn back. If the dog doesn't he or she will be greeted with a shock.
Note: Before you start this new stuff to your dog, they need to be introduced to what you're doing and you won't get all this done in a day or two. You can use flags or cones so your dog will know what's expected. After a few trips around the yard the pet will get it. Remember, dogs are smarter than you think.
